IMSI has an OS X version of TurboCAD for the Mac.
There isn't much detail -- such as is this a port, or a new program with the TurboCAD label? Reading between the lines, this first version is 2D only: "IMSI plans to release a second, 2D/3D version of TurboCAD for Mac OS X later this year." Another hint: it comes with a 3D-2D converter for flattening 3D drawings.
The Web site has not yet been updated with this new information. Price is US$99.

Dassault Systemes also ports Cosmic Blobs to the Macintosh -- 3D graphics software ever for kids. Available in July for US$45.
New version 1.1 for PC and Mac adds movie file capture; improved content; expanded user interface. There'll be expansion packs in the fugure: Critter Chaos is included free, and has animal-themed models, textures, decals, animations, and background options.
